I'm interested to buy oil and hold for a few months, looking for a reliable swap-free broker...
 
 
  • Post #15
  • Quote
  • Feb 12, 2016 4:42am Feb 12, 2016 4:42am
  •  sbc
  • | Joined Dec 2014 | Status: Member | 311 Posts
trade futures with a broker and you won't pay holding costs/swap . You need to worry about roll cost only if you hold longer than 1 month expiry.
